-"Animoog, powered by the new Anisotropic Synth Engine (ASE), is Moog Music's first professional polyphonic synthesizer designed exclusively for the iPad. ASE allows you to move dynamically through an X/Y space of unique timbres to create a constantly evolving and expressive soundscape.(App store description)+Animoog is a well-regarded iOS synthesizer available in iPhone and iPad versionsBoth versions use the identical audio engine but have slightly different user interfaces. On the iPad, you can run an instance of each appThe Anisotropic Synth Engine is a variety of wavetable synthesis that morphs between 8 timbres (wavetables)
  
 +App store description: //Animoog, powered by the new Anisotropic Synth Engine (ASE), is Moog Music's first professional polyphonic synthesizer designed exclusively for the iPad. ASE allows you to move dynamically through an X/Y space of unique timbres to create a constantly evolving and expressive soundscape.//
